General Scheme of the Health (Exemption for Children from Public In-Patient Charges) Bill 2022

The Bill proposes to abolish acute public in-patient charges for children under 16. Primary legislation is required to amend the Health Act 1970 to abolish the public in-patient charge for children under 16 years of age.
The proposed amendments will remove the acute public in-patient charge of €80 per day, up to a maximum of €800 in a year, for children less than 16 years of age in all public hospitals.
